## Budgeting Tools: Stay on Top of Your Finances

One of the first steps to taking control of your finances is creating a budget. Budgeting tools like Mint, YNAB (You Need A Budget), and Personal Capital can help you track your income and expenses, set financial goals, and monitor your progress. These tools can automatically categorize your transactions, send alerts for upcoming bills, and provide insights on your spending habits. By using a budgeting tool, you can make informed decisions about where your money is going and identify areas where you can cut back or save more.

## Investment Platforms: Grow Your Wealth

Investing is a key component of building wealth over the long term. Robo-advisors like Wealthfront, Betterment, and Acorns offer automated investment management services that can help you create and manage a diversified investment portfolio. These platforms use algorithms to determine the optimal asset allocation based on your risk tolerance and investment goals. They also offer features like automatic rebalancing, tax-loss harvesting, and goal-based investing. With the help of an investment platform, you can start investing with as little as a few dollars and benefit from professional investment management without the high fees.

## Retirement Planning Tools: Secure Your Future

Planning for retirement is essential to ensure financial security in your golden years. Retirement planning tools like Personal Capital, FutureAdvisor, and Retirement Planner by Vanguard can help you estimate your retirement income needs, assess your current retirement savings, and develop a personalized retirement plan. These tools take into account factors like your age, income, savings rate, and retirement goals to provide recommendations on how much you need to save and invest to reach your retirement goals. By using a retirement planning tool, you can take the guesswork out of retirement planning and make informed decisions about your financial future.
